Bienvenue au monde !

Développeur Web, je lis de temps en temps des bouquins, et quotidiennement tout un tas de blogs. J’ai récemment lu quelques livres : Practices of an Agile Developer et Test Driven Development.

Practices of an Agile Developer pousse à être plus réaliste. Il ne m’a pas fondamentalement remis en cause, mais il m’a remis les points sur « i », notamment sur «comment ne pas perdre son temps ? » En gros : ne pas se prendre la tête à programmer ses propres outils (eg: un framework) lorsque d’autres l’ont déjà fait, et bien fait. Autant passer tout ce temps économisé à se concentrer sur ses projets.

Test Driven Development est quant-à lui un livre à lire absolument. Je connaissais un peu les xUnit, mais sans vraiment en comprendre l’intérêt ni la manière de le mettre en œuvre et ne m’y suis jamais vraiment intéressé. L’auteur, Kent Beck, m’a fait comprendre pourquoi les tests unitaires sont indispensable à tout projet et toute l’importance de programmer d’abord les tests. Le développement d’une application se simplifie et l’évolution d’une fonction ou d’une classe ne devient plus une source d’angoisse, mais un moteur. Il suffit de lancer ses tests automatiques pour vérifier si quelque chose a été cassé, auquel cas on répare, sinon tout continuera à marcher comme avant. C’est tout bête, mais c’est génial.

Malheureusement ces livres ne sont pas disponibles en français — tout comme beaucoup de ressources sur la programmation — pourtant indispensables. Tout le monde n’a pas un niveau suffisant en anglais, ni la motivation pour se farcir un livre de programmation en anglais dans le texte.

Je me suis donc décidé à commencer un blog, en français. Pour moi et les gens qui ne parlent pas suffisamment anglais pour lire Test Driven Development et Rails for PHP Developers par exemple.

Je parlerai bien entendu aussi de choses diverses concernant la programmation Web, tel JavaScript et Internet Explorer par exemple, ou encore les frameworks, etc.

Laisser un commentaire

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Logo WordPress.com

Vous commentez à l'aide de votre compte WordPress.com. Déconnexion / Changer )

Image Twitter

Vous commentez à l'aide de votre compte Twitter. Déconnexion / Changer )

Photo Facebook

Vous commentez à l'aide de votre compte Facebook. Déconnexion / Changer )

Photo Google+

Vous commentez à l'aide de votre compte Google+. Déconnexion / Changer )

Connexion à %s


%d blogueurs aiment cette page :